酸活化坡缕石对肉鸡日粮中黄曲霉毒素B_1的去毒效果 被引量:10

Efficacy of Modified Palygorskite to Ameliorate the Toxic Effects of Aflatoxin B_1 in Broilers

摘要 4 8 0只 1日龄艾维因商品代肉鸡 ,按饲养试验要求分为 4组 :基础日粮组 (对照组 ) ; .基础日粮 +0 .2 5 %活化坡缕石组 ; .霉变玉米 5 0 %代替基础日粮中的玉米组 ,使黄曲霉毒素 B1 前期为 97μg/ kg,后期为 10 8μg/ kg; .第 组日粮 +0 .2 5 %活化坡缕石组。研究了酸活化坡缕石对肉鸡日粮中黄曲霉素 B1 的去毒作用。结果表明 ,与对照组相比 ,添加 0 .2 5 %活化坡缕石对肉鸡生长性能、内脏器官相对重量、血清生化指标和免疫指标均无显著影响 ,而霉变玉米可使肉鸡生长性能显著降低 ,肝脏率、心脏率、肾脏率、腺胃率、谷草转氨酶、谷丙转氨酶、碱性磷酸酶、谷胱甘肽硫转移酶活性显著提高 ,血清中 Ig G、Ig A、C3、C4 显著降低 ;联合饲喂霉变玉米 /活化坡缕石可使肉鸡生长性能、内脏器官相对重量、血清生化指标和免疫指标均恢复至对照组水平。上述结果提示 ,活化坡缕石对肉鸡日粮中黄曲霉毒素 B1 Four hundred and eighty Avian broiler chicks,1 day old,were randomly allocated to four treatments for 42 days,which included:1)basal diet(control);2)basal diet supplemented with 0.25% MP;3) fifty percent of the corn in the basal diet was replaced by moldy corn and the concentrations of AFB_1 in prophase and anaphase are 97 and 108 μg/kg of diet,respectively;4)the third diet plus 0.25% MP.The addition of MP to chick diets at a level of 0.25% had no significant effects on chick performance,organ weights,serum chemistry or immune function.In chicks fed the diet containing moldy corn alone,the performance significantly decreased,the relative weights of the liver,kidney,heart,proventriculus,and the levels of serum GPT,GOT,ALP and GSH-ST significantly increased,and the concentrations of serum IgG,IgA,C_3,C_4 significantly decreased.Chicks fed the combination moldy corn/MP diet had similar performance,organ weights,serum chemistry values and immune function was similar to that of control chicks.These results indicated that MP was proved to be effective in preventing the toxic effects of AF in broilers.
